- The distance between Macon, Georgia, Usa and Taejon, North Korea is approximately 11,685 km or 7,261 mi.
- To reach Macon, Georgia in this distance one would set out from Taejon bearing 26.7°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Macon, Georgia bearing 154.5° or SSE .
- Macon, Georgia has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Taejon has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
- Macon, Georgia is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Taejon is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 5.9 °C (10.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.9 °C (14.2°F) less in Macon, Georgia.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 226.3 mm (8.9 in) less which is equivalent to 226.3 l/m² (5.55 US gal/ft²) or 2,263,000 l/ha (241,930 US gal/ac) less. About 5/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.7° higher in Macon, Georgia than in Taejon.
- Relative humidity levels are 22%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 0.1°C (0.2°F) higher.
